Civil officers call on CJP.

Getting your Trinity Audio player ready...

ISLAMABAD: A 53-member delegation of senior civil officers from various groups with seven faculty/staff members of the National Management College, the National School of Public Policy, Lahore, on Wednesday called on Chief Justice of Pakistan Justice Iftikhar Muhammad Chaudhry.

The chief justice, while addressing the delegation, gave a brief account of the various jurisdictions of the Supreme Court, functioning of the court, the role assigned to the superior judiciary in interpreting the Constitution and law.

The chief justice said that the Supreme Court was initially created under the 1956 Constitution and hitherto, it was called the Federal Court. He said that the Supreme Court was the highest judicial body under the Constitutions of 1956, 1962 and then of course interim constitution of 1972 and Constitution of 1973. Later, Shafiq Hussain Bukhari, chief instructor of the college, presented a shield to chief justice.
